originally posted by: NeoSpace
Here in the UK I've been waiting over 4 weeks now and still nothing, no income at all.


Have you been furloughed by an employer or are you self employed?

If you have been furloughed, then payments will be made to your employer at the end of April.

If you are self employed, then it will be June at the earliest that any payments will be made. This will also depend on whether you have submitted your annual tax return. If you haven’t then you have until 23rd April to do so, otherwise zilch will be paid, according to an article I read today.
